A Lovely Girl's Lovely Dreams offers a poignant exploration of unrequited love and the complex interplay of societal expectations. The film captures Mui Yee-wah's emotional turmoil beautifully with its lush cinematography and moody atmosphere. Tso Kea's direction is subtly expressive, allowing the raw performances to shine through—especially in scenes depicting Mui's grief when love seems just out of reach. The age difference between the leads adds an unsettling layer, complicating Mui's attraction to the married painter Wai Tik-fung. Rich heir Siu Kar-wai’s pursuit of Mui feels less like a romance and more like a commentary on materialism in love, which adds to the film's depth. It’s a mix of heartbreak and beauty, resonating long after the credits roll.
